Big Island *takes first step* in banning GMO's
The thing about those countries that require labelling... and I hate having to go over this again... is that none of them has the US Constitution.

It's very instructive to read the court decision that struck down the Vermont law requiring labels on milk from cows that had been treated with rBGH hormone. They said, basically, that there are many things a consumer might wish to know about the milk they were about to buy, like what the cow was fed, and maybe even what the cow's name was, but absent some compelling public reason, the government can't force anyone... individual or company... to share information they don't wish to.

More than that, when a label has been demonized, and given a negative connotation in the public's perception without any credible scientific proof, that requiring such a label is a volation of their Constitutional rights.

So can we please put this GMO label thing to rest now? Not gonna happen, even if a law gets passed. It's unconstitutional.
